PM departs for Azerbaijan on two-day official visit

Lahore, February 23, 2025: Prime Minister Shehbaz Sharif on Sunday embarked on a two-day official visit to Azerbaijan at the invitation of Azerbaijani President Ilham Aliyev.

This marks PM Shehbaz’s second visit to Azerbaijan since assuming office in March 2024. Accompanying him are Deputy Prime Minister and Foreign Minister Muhammad Ishaq Dar, along with federal ministers Jam Kamal Khan, Abdul Aleem Khan, Chaudhry Salik Hussain, Attaullah Tarar, and Special Assistant Tariq Fatemi.

During the visit, the Prime Minister will hold bilateral meetings with President Ilham Aliye, address a business forum to promote economic collaboration to discuss key areas of mutual interest, including energy cooperation, trade and investment, defence and security, education and cultural exchange and climate action initiatives.

Multiple Memorandums of Understanding (MoUs) and agreements will be signed to strengthen bilateral ties and economic collaboration between the two nations.
